Araraquara Climate

Araraquara has an average annual temperature of 20.9°C (70°F) and receives about 1338 mm of precipitation per year. The warmest month is January and the coldest is July. Figures are 1970–2000 climate normals.

Araraquara — monthly temperature & precipitation (1970–2000 normals) · Source: WorldClim 2.1
MonthAvg (°C/°F)Precip
January23° / 74°239 mm
February23° / 74°212 mm
March23° / 73°158 mm
April21° / 70°54 mm
May19° / 66°44 mm
June18° / 64°35 mm
July17° / 63°24 mm
August19° / 66°21 mm
September21° / 69°49 mm
October22° / 71°127 mm
November23° / 73°154 mm
December23° / 73°221 mm

1970–2000 normals from WorldClim 2.1 (~9 km grid). Precipitation can be less precise near mountains or coastlines, where rainfall varies sharply over short distances.

Best time to visit Araraquara

The most comfortable months to visit Araraquara are typically September, April and August, when temperatures are mildest and rainfall is relatively low. The hottest month is January (around 29°C high). The coldest is July (near 10°C low). January is usually the wettest month.
